Output 89e3609b768d3c7a67bf5dc37e81e118f64f0969eb04c3a6e82e3885078a52d9:286

value
840199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fafabb2b95b10dd264339c2d55f474a4776799b OP_EQUAL
address
38xMkWfb9iE7CY4kjrpwpfNDRBUChXHaAs
transaction
89e3609b768d3c7a67bf5dc37e81e118f64f0969eb04c3a6e82e3885078a52d9
spent
true